    Stayed in the Presidential Suite. It was okay. The suya and barbecue fish is good. The curry sauce is good as well. Be prepared to go up a lot of steps if you are in the fourth floor. They have power 24 - 7. Be prepared to wait 1 hour for your food, because they make them after you order (maybe this is a Nigerian thing), but it is worth the wait. Pack your swim wear....they have a good pool. The beds are very hard. If you are here in December....you will not need the AC open the window and enjoy the the cool harmattan wind.

    Rooms were manageable. The bathroom floor was broken and felt like it would sink into the ground. The pool has a barrier around it, and that's a good and safe one. However, when we checked out, we were stopped as we drove out of the premises because they found a pink stain on their towel! 😨 The security at the gate was told not to let us out. I don't know if they wanted us to go back and wash the towel or buy them some bleach or order a washing machine, because I couldn't even understand what they wanted us to do about a silly freaking stain their towel. I've never heard or encountered this in any hotel worldwide. I was disappointed to say the least.
